Rabies deaths: Rights panel calls for effective treatment protocol

THE Kerala State Human Rights Commission has taken serious note of the incidents where people — including children in recent cases — have reportedly died of rabies despite receiving vaccinations.

Judicial member K Baijunath issued a directive to the chief secretary and the additional chief secretary (Local Self-Government Department), urging the immediate implementation of a foolproof rabies treatment protocol to prevent such lapses in the future.

Baijunath highlighted the growing threat posed by the stray dog population across the state, calling the situation alarming.
